As I think about the scene where Jesus heals a guy from the dreaded skin disease of leprosy – instant healing really stuns me. Check this out….

1Large crowds followed Jesus as he came down the mountainside. Suddenly, a man with leprosy approached him and knelt before him. “Lord,” the man said, “if you are willing, you can heal me and make me clean.”

Jesus reached out and touched him. “I am willing,” he said. “Be healed!” And instantly the leprosy disappeared. Then Jesus said to him, “Don’t tell anyone about this. Instead, go to the priest and let him examine you. Take along the offering required in the law of Moses for those who have been healed of leprosy. This will be a public testimony that you have been cleansed.” (Matthew 8:1-4 NLT)

I was also struck by “if you are willing” – there was deep humility all over this guy. He was at the mercy of Jesus. He was an outcast because of the leprosy. He was already violating the proper protocol for having the disease. He was to be quarantined from anyone without the disease. When people were diagnosed with leprosy, their normal lives were over. They couldn’t be around their family. They couldn’t work a normal job. There was now a stigma that would follow them the rest of their lives – BUT Jesus changed all of that – instantly!!
